Research project: Machine Learning Algorithms for Gaming in Support of People with Disabilities

Abstract

This proposal presents the scope of the PhD, gives a brief explanation of the subject and the aims of the research describes the methodology and the approach to the research and present the timescale to achieve this target. The machine learning is part of computer science and subject in the context of artificial intelligence. Algorithms are developed and manufactured on computer models using data in order to forecast and exported decisions for the purpose of machine learning. Machine learning is very close and often confused with computational statistics aimed at prediction using computers. Also, machine learning is applied to a series of computational tasks requiring implementation of flexible algorithms for drawing conclusions.
